    "HOOKED ON HABITAT" IS A REEL WINNER!By:EllenCardillo

    The 6th Annual "Hooked on Habitat" Redfish Tournament reeled in anglers from Tampa to Naples with 42 boats and over 120 anglers participating. This event is supported by many businesses including Ingman Marine as the named sponsor. Our sponsors provided the anglers with a great day of fishing and an opportunity to win more than $5,000 in prizes! After a delicious seafood Captains Dinner on Friday night provided by Peace River Seafood, the anglers left Laishley Marina early Saturday morning to fish for a good cause. The generosity of sponsors, partners, volunteers, anglers and donors helped Charlotte County Habitat raise over $20,000 for their mission of helping local families in need of safe, decent, affordable homes! Tony Cissell, a Habitat partner family, helped serve food and set up the event in an effort to earn his "sweat equity" hours required of partner families approved for home ownership. Facing enormous medical bills, Tony could see himself falling further and further behind. Habitat offered him hope and a home. Jay Gordon, Board President for Charlotte County Habitat, stated, "These events give meaning to what we do. The people are so full of gratitude, theres so much emotion. It changes their lives." Thank you to all that participated.

    CHARLOTTE COUNTY FEMALES GRAB YOUR TOOLS!Thanks to the participation of local women during our successful Women Build 2014 project, Kirsten and her two daughters are living in their safe, affordable Charlotte County home. Were ready to do it again! Women Build 2015 is on our schedule to begin during March, 2015, but the project cant be a success without your support.

    Groups and individual women raised funds and hammers during our Women Build 2014 project. Fundraising efforts included quarter auctions, garage sales, quilt raffles and more. Participants wore their pink shirts while building interior walls, raising trusses, and painting. By Mothers Day 2014 the new homeowner and her daughters were enjoying their new home.
